The Internet of Things (IoT) represents a transformative shift in how gadgets interact and talk. Understanding how IoT connectivity works is crucial to understand the implications and potential of this know-how. IoT refers to a community of interconnected devices outfitted with sensors, software, and other technologies that enable them to gather and exchange knowledge over the Internet.


In essence, IoT connectivity facilitates communication between various units and platforms, enabling them to share data seamlessly. This interconnectedness extends past simple units to incorporate advanced methods like smart houses, industrial machines, and even whole cities. As such, the infrastructure that helps IoT must handle an unlimited amount of knowledge and connections concurrently.


For IoT techniques to operate effectively, they utilize numerous communication protocols similar to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, Zigbee, and cellular networks. Each of those protocols has strengths and weaknesses tailored to particular use circumstances (IoT Connectivity Managementplatform). Wi-Fi is prevalent in home and workplace settings due to its high information switch charges, while Bluetooth is more suitable for short-range applications, like wearable devices.


Zigbee and LoRaWAN are important in smart metropolis purposes because of their low energy requirements and ability to transmit information over long distances. These protocols contribute to the grid of devices that constantly relay info to improve performance and efficiency. For example, smart meters utilize these protocols to ship crucial data to utility firms, aiding in efficient energy administration.

The data collected by IoT gadgets typically undergoes processing earlier than it might be utilized. Edge computing is a mannequin where information processing occurs close to the data's supply rather than a centralized knowledge center. By processing knowledge on the edge, latency is decreased, and bandwidth is saved, as solely essential info is sent to the cloud. This mannequin proves helpful in situations requiring real-time evaluation, corresponding to autonomous vehicles or smart manufacturing.


Cloud computing enhances IoT connectivity by offering expansive storage capacity and analytics capabilities. Once the info has been analyzed, actionable insights may be derived to inform decision-making processes. For instance, in healthcare, linked medical devices can monitor patients and alert healthcare suppliers if pressing action is needed.


Security stays a crucial concern in IoT connectivity. As gadgets turn out to be extra interconnected, the potential attack surfaces multiply, making them engaging targets for cybercriminals. Implementing sturdy security protocols, such as encryption, two-factor authentication, and common firmware updates, is crucial to safeguarding delicate knowledge. The shared vulnerability of linked devices means that security have to be thought of at every stage of the IoT growth and deployment process.


Interoperability is another vital problem in the IoT panorama. Various producers and repair suppliers may utilize totally different protocols and standards, which may create limitations in seamless communication. Open standards and frameworks important link are being developed to mitigate these points, enabling devices from different manufacturers to work together harmoniously. This cooperation can considerably enhance user experience and general system efficiency.

The benefits of IoT connectivity permeate various industries, offering alternatives for efficiency and innovation. In agriculture, IoT sensors can track soil moisture and weather circumstances, allowing farmers to optimize irrigation and scale back waste. In manufacturing, real-time monitoring systems can forecast gear failures, helping to take care of continuous manufacturing.


Smart cities leverage IoT connectivity to enhance city living. Traffic management systems can analyze real-time data to optimize site visitors circulate and cut back congestion. Similarly, smart waste administration systems utilize sensors to observe waste levels, ensuring well timed pickups and useful resource efficiency. These improvements reveal how IoT connectivity can improve daily life on a quantity of levels.

  • IoT connectivity depends on numerous communication protocols such as MQTT, CoAP, and HTTP, which facilitate data exchange between devices and servers efficiently.

  • Devices geared up with sensors acquire information and utilize network connectivity, both by way of Wi-Fi, cellular, or low-power wide-area networks (LPWAN), to transmit this data.

  • Cloud platforms play a important position in IoT connectivity, allowing for centralized data storage, processing, and management, which can be accessed by authorized customers through the internet.

  • The integration of edge computing enhances IoT functionality by processing data closer to the supply, lowering latency and bandwidth utilization.

  • Security measures, including encryption and authentication, are essential in IoT connectivity to protect sensitive information from unauthorized entry and potential cyber threats.

  • Interoperability standards enable disparate IoT devices from different producers to speak and work collectively seamlessly within a unified system.

  • API (Application Programming Interface) integrations allow IoT gadgets to work together with third-party purposes, enriching overall functionality and information analysis capabilities.

  • Network topology, which describes the arrangement of linked IoT units, impacts overall system efficiency, reliability, and scalability.

  • Real-time knowledge analytics is often carried out on knowledge aggregated from connected units, enabling predictive maintenance, smart decision-making, and improved operational effectivity.
